Job Description

Position Title

Clinical Paramedic - Emergency Department - PRNGreat Bend Hospital

Career Interest:

The Emergency Department Clinical Paramedic provides paramedic service, to patients in the Emergency Department, that are within the scope of the Paramedic's State Paramedic certification. Responsible for implementing technical procedures and care to patients safely and effectively. Any service provided directly to a patient must be pursuant to protocols, procedures, and policies of the hospital and pursuant in a variety of ED settings including triage, trauma, and general patient care.

The clinical Paramedic will function within the scope of practice and perform additional tasks approved by the medical director of the emergency department. The clinical paramedic will work in conjunction with the ED staff to care for and manage patients. Carrying out plans of care by completing delegated tasks as assigned, maintaining clinical and technical competencies, and utilizing resources appropriately. Demonstrates exemplary teamwork, critical thinking skills, and communication with other members of the healthcare team to ensure safe, effective, and quality patient care, maintaining professionalism always.

Responsibilities and Essential Job Functions

  • Collects and assess, initial and on-going data about the health status of the patient
  • Initiates and/or revises an individualized plan of care that includes immediate and long-term outcomes for the patient/family and reflects the plan of the entire health care team.
  • Carries out interventions safely and in compliance with policy to facilitate achievement of expected outcomes.
  • Evaluates patient response to intervention/therapy based upon expected outcomes.
  • Provides patient education by explaining procedures, medications, and giving instructions at a level the patient can understand.
  • Address’s patients’ questions and concerns.
  • Documents and communicates all required components of patient care.
  • Provides care to acutely and critically ill patients, in a highly technical and ongoing monitoring environment.
  • Offers unsolicited assistance for help
  • Administration of all medications approved by Emergency Department Medical Director.
  • Assists organizational EVS employees with room turn-over and preparation for patient care areas for additional patients
  • Completes delegated tasks in a timely manner
  • Employs strategies to promote health in a safe environment and ensures patient safety
  • Ensures excellent communication with all other staff members and team members
  • Ensures that all interventions and/or patient interactions are appropriately documented in the patient’s medical record
  • Ensures the work environment is clean and tidy, and without clutter
  • Maintains exceptional phlebotomy skills including obtaining and labeling specimens without difficulty and per hospital policy (within scope of practice) and yearly competencies per hospital policy
  • Participates in the department Haz-Mat training and maintains competency to appropriately don and doff all Haz-Mat materials, as well as participate in decontamination of any contaminated patients
  • Performs assigned clinical duties such as EKG completion, patient registration, patient transportation, point-of-care testing, and ensures that all results are documented and reported to the appropriate healthcare provider
  • Must be able to perform the professional, clinical and or technical competencies of the assigned unit or department.
